International Wave Dance Song Competition
The International Wave Dance Song Competition invites musicians and songwriters worldwide to compose a signature song for the Wave Dance Initiative—a global movement that uses dance to raise awareness about ocean conservation and protection.
Key Dates
Opens: 17th February 2025 (Registration & guidelines available online)
Deadline: 30th April 2025
The competition will be judged by an international panel, chaired by Ambassador Patrick Victor.
Awards & Prizes
Winner receives:
-
$5,000 USD cash prize, sponsored by African Mosaïque Design Centre
-
Trophy & Certificate, awarded by the Danny Faure Foundation
Who Can Participate?
This competition is open to musicians, composers, and songwriters from around the world who share a passion for using music as a tool for raising awareness about environmental conservation.
About the Wave Dance Initiative
The Wave Dance Initiative is a global movement that combines dance and music to inspire action and raise awareness about the importance of protecting our oceans. By creating a signature song for this initiative, participants contribute to a powerful artistic campaign for marine conservation.
